About Maidevera
As of July 27, 2026, Maidevera is filled to 90.0% of its total capacity, holding roughly 18 hm³ of water out of a maximum 20 hm³. At this level the reservoir is high. Of that total, about 18 hm³ is usable (live) storage.
Over the most recent week on record the fill level has held broadly steady (+0.0 pts), and it is 20.0 points above its level on the same date a year earlier.
Across the readings we hold for Maidevera — 420 data points between July 17, 2018 and July 27, 2026 — the level has ranged from a low of 20.0% (September 5, 2023) to a high of 100.0% (June 23, 2020). On average the reservoir is fullest around June and at its lowest around October.
It is operated by CHE primarily for multiple purposes. It lies within the Ebro basin at 41.579°N, 1.763°W.
